A plane cuts through a cone perpendicular to the base of the cone. What shape is formed by this intersection?

Respuesta :

kjyang kjyang
  • 16-03-2017
A triangle, because if you can visualize it, perpendicular to the base would create a PLUS sign. ( + ) and cutting the cone from the bottom up would create a shape from the INSIDE that is a triangle.
